Solution System

From The Practical Ontology & Compendium of Social Cohesion

Definition: As used herein, Solution-System refers to cooperative human activity beyond one’s Household that comes into existence in an attempt to Solve an Extraordinary Problem. Commentary Twenty thousand years ago, our ancestors were hunter-gatherers. They had various Solution-Systems that must have Solved various Extraordinary Problems well enough such that we are here today. Solution-Systems back then were Aspects of one's Group. Social Cohesion was an integral Aspect of all Solution-Systems. Today, however, we tend to identify a Solution-Systems with one or more Organizations where Social Cohesion is not necessarily present.
